Summary: Customize your peg, hop in your car and race your friends and family through THE GAME OF LIFE 2 game, a contemporary multiplayer sequel to THE GAME OF LIFE board game. ![]() ![]() It is also almost impossible to keep a leather muzzle hygienic. But many dogs are bothered by the smell of leather or the smell of the tannins. Leather dog muzzles are lightweight and comfortable to wear, at least initially. Usually, giving treats is possible without any problems with these muzzles. But this is also a minus point, because it also increases the risk of other injuries, such as bruising. A plus point is the high stability of the wire muzzles, which reliably prevent biting. They are usually heavy and get freezing cold in winter. Wire muzzles or metal muzzles have a frightening effect on many people because of their appearance. The advantages of plastic muzzles are obvious: they are usually lightweight and easy to clean. Some models make it difficult to give treats. Less high-quality models can quickly break when exposed to cold or too much force. Special attention should be paid to high-quality workmanship. There are many models of plastic muzzles. The question of which muzzle to use does not arise here. This is relevant to animal welfare and can quickly become dangerous and lead to the dogs overheating. ![]() It also prevents the dog from panting and drinking. The dog cannot open his mouth when wearing it. ![]() ![]() The nylon muzzle loopĪ nylon muzzle loop is not a muzzle! It does not prevent biting. It is used for fence posts, fuel, and general construction.Several species fall under the Oak Tree genus, Quercus. ![]() The nutsĪre often striate, and the cups are reddish brown and finely hairy or hairless. Hemispherical in shape, the cup being thin and saucer-shaped. They can occur with or without stalks, and are nearly The male flowers appear as catkins and the femaleįlowers in groups of 1-3 just as the leaves begin to unfold.Īre 1/2 inch long and up to 1/2 inch across, and are borne singly or in Is monoecious both male (staminate) and female (pistillate) flowers areīorne on the same tree. Dead leaves tend to remain on the tree in the winter. They are dark green and shiny on the upper surface and paler with tufts of hair along the veins on the underside. ![]() They are up to 7 inches long and up to 4 inches broad, with a slender leaf stalk up to 2 inches long. The leaves are alternate and simple, with 5-7 deeply incised, bristle-tipped lobes. It is smooth when young, developing shallow furrows as it ages.Īre slender and reddish brown to gray brown and shiny.Īre approximately 1/8 inch long, reddish brown and are sharp pointed. Its bark is lighter gray or reddish brown when young, becoming or darker gray brown when mature. Pin oak is a member of the red oak group. The winter-persistent leaves and the pin-like stubs (which remain after the lower branches of pin oak are lost as the tree matures) are the most distinctive characteristics of the tree. Hill's oak leaves turn color and are shed in the autumn. Pin oak leaves turn red or brown in the fall and persist on the tree during the winter. Whereas pin oak grows in moist, bottomland soils, Hill's oak prefers drier upland soils. The trees also differ in their habitat preferences. It is distinguished from Hill's oak by its acorns, which are shorter and covered by a shallower cup than those of Hill's oak which are about twice as long and taper. Pin oak is very similar to Hill's or northern pin oak. It grows on sites with a 'claypan' such as Illinois flatwoods, which tend to be very wet, with standing water at the surface in the winter and spring. Overall, it commonly grows on sites that flood occasionally, but not during the growing season. Oklahoma east to northern Virginia, it occurs in moist, clay soils. Of its range from Massachusetts, west to southeastern Iowa and south to It is common in floodplainsĪlong streams and at the edges of swamps and ponds. To marshes) in almost every county in Illinois.
